Heads up: our Brindlewick build agents drift. Agent pool C runs a few seconds fast, which breaks timestamp-signed artifact uploads to the Quorvane cache. We pin NTP sync in the bootstrap script, but the signer still needs its token locally. Set SKEW_TOLERANCE_MS=5000 in the agent env file, and directly after that line add the signer credential as follows.

vault entry, yahif-yajep: COURIER_KEY29=b802bdf8034096b65a51c6ba5abe2

# Basement Archive Room — Night Access

The archive room under Pellworth House holds old contracts and the tape backups. Night shift: take stairwell C, not the lift (it's switched off after midnight). Lights are on a timer by the door — slap the button as you go in. Sign the logbook, even at 3am, yes really. The keypad by the door takes the code below.

staff pass of fahap-tajeg = bdg-FT-6

Step 2: Load test the Bramblecart checkout flow before cutover. Point the harness at the staging gateway, ramp to 500 rps over ten minutes, hold for twenty. Watch p99 on payment-auth; abort above 900ms. Disable rate limiting on staging only. Results go in the run log. The harness needs the staging payment sandbox credential in its env file, which goes on the line after this.

secret setting of tajog-bafog: RELAY_SECRET13=8f6af7680fb2b